JEMBER, INDONESIA – PT Rafandra Eternal Nusantara has achieved a monumental milestone in its mission to blend environmental sustainability with local community empowerment. Out of 3,485 competitive applicant teams from across the nation, the Jember-based ecopreneur has been officially selected as one of the top 110 Young Leaders in the Sociopreneur category by the Pertamina Foundation.

 

This prestigious national recognition places Rafandra Eternal Nusantara among a select group of visionary changemakers, cementing their status as one of only 16 Young Leaders chosen from the East Java province.

 

The Magic of Loofah: Redefining the Natural Sponge Market

At the heart of Rafandra Eternal Nusantara’s success is its signature innovation: transforming the humble loofah plant (gambas/blustru) into high-quality, 100% biodegradable natural sponges. While mainstream markets rely heavily on synthetic plastic sponges that break down into microplastics, Rafandra offers a zero-waste alternative.

 

By sourcing dried loofah directly from local farmers in Jember, the company crafts an array of eco-friendly solutions, including:

  • Natural Kitchen Sponges: High-durability dishwashing scrubbers that are entirely compostable.
  • Exfoliating Loofah Pads: Premium spa and bath scrubbers designed to naturally cleanse the skin.
  • Zero-Waste Soap Bags & Mesh: Creative utilities that maximize soap use while prioritizing planet health.

 

Driving Green Employment in Jember

The Pertamina Foundation recognition highlights Rafandra Eternal Nusantara's dual impact: tackling regional unemployment while pioneering Indonesia's green economy. By building a sustainable business around loofah and coconut fiber agriculture, the enterprise has created a stable supply chain that directly generates green jobs for the local community.
